If you are rolling a number cube, each roll is a separate and independent event. That means that to find the probability of the first event happening and the second event happening, you find the individual probabilities of each event and then multiply them.
P(roll a 4) = 1/6
P(roll an even number) = P(roll 2, 4, or 6) = 3/6
P(roll a 4, then roll an even number) = 1/6 * 3/6 = 3/36 = 1/12
